Overview

Modified GRF 1-29 is a synthetic analogue of growth hormone releasing hormone (GHRH) comprising 29 amino acids with four amino acid substitutions to enhance stability. These modifications increase resistance to enzymatic degradation compared to native GHRH while maintaining receptor affinity and biological activity.

Mechanism of Action

The compound stimulates pulsatile growth hormone release from the anterior pituitary without the half-life extension conferred by drug affinity complex technology.

Research Summary & Key Findings

Preclinical studies have demonstrated enhanced growth hormone secretion and improved pharmacokinetic stability relative to native GHRH. No formal clinical trials have been published in peer-reviewed literature, and the compound lacks regulatory evaluation by major health authorities. Its use has been primarily documented in performance enhancement contexts outside approved therapeutic settings.

Clinical Status

Research Phase

Mod GRF 1-29 (CJC-1295 no DAC) is in the research phase with limited clinical data in humans. Current evidence is primarily derived from preclinical (animal or in vitro) studies.
